McCallie Student Will Hunt Gets New Heart

  • Thursday, November 17, 2016

A McCallie School student who has been in need of a new heart has undergone a successful transplant at Vanderbilt Hospital.

The family of Will Hunt said his new heart was beating on its own after an eight-hour surgery overnight.

The surgery began at 2 a.m. and he was taken to the Intensive Care Unit for recovery by 10 a.m.

He is a graduate of Bright School, which was collecting donations for the Hunt family and organizing a Thanksgiving dinner for them at the hospital.

The 16-year-old earlier gained attention through a video of him singing at the hospital.
